지난번엔 동호회를 Club 이라는 리소스로 만들었다.동호회에 속한 User 를 의미하는 Member 리소스를 생성해보자. Resource 정의 defmodule Hoing.Clubs.Member do # ... attributes do uuid_v7_primary_key :id attribute :role, :atom, constraints: [one_of: [:owner, :manager, :member]]...
최근 개인적인 개발을 할 때 Ash Framework 를 사용한다.Ash Framework 홈페이지를 보면 아래와 같은 문구가 있다. Model your domain, derive the reset 꽤나 잘 만든 문구라고 생각한다. 실제로 Ash 로 개발을 해보면 정말로 그렇다는 것을 느낀다. Ash 는 단순한 코드로 복잡한 사용성을 커버할 수 있는 프레임워크이다.Ash 로 개발하면 HTML 이나 SQL 같은 언어처럼 선언적인 코드를 작성하게...